On Mon, Oct 06, 2025 at 09:31:43PM +0200, Benno Lossin wrote:
> On Mon Oct 6, 2025 at 6:30 PM CEST, Onur Özkan wrote:
> > Implements `alloc` function to `XArray<T>` that wraps
> > `xa_alloc` safely.
> >
> > Resolves a task from the nova/core task list under the "XArray
> > bindings [XARR]" section in "Documentation/gpu/nova/core/todo.rst"
> > file.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Onur Özkan <work@onurozkan.dev>
> > ---
> >  rust/kernel/xarray.rs | 39 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
> >  1 file changed, 39 insertions(+)
> >
> > diff --git a/rust/kernel/xarray.rs b/rust/kernel/xarray.rs
> > index a49d6db28845..1b882cd2f58b 100644
> > --- a/rust/kernel/xarray.rs
> > +++ b/rust/kernel/xarray.rs
> > @@ -266,6 +266,45 @@ pub fn store(
> >              Ok(unsafe { T::try_from_foreign(old) })
> >          }
> >      }
> > +
> > +    /// Allocates an empty slot within the given limit range and stores `value` there.
> > +    ///
> > +    /// May drop the lock if needed to allocate memory, and then reacquire it afterwards.
> > +    ///
> > +    /// On success, returns the allocated id.
> > +    ///
> > +    /// On failure, returns the element which was attempted to be stored.
> > +    pub fn alloc(
> > +        &mut self,
> > +        limit: bindings::xa_limit,
> > +        value: T,
> > +        gfp: alloc::Flags,
> > +    ) -> Result<u32, StoreError<T>> {
> 
> I think it would be a good idea to make the id a newtype wrapper around
> u32. Maybe not even allow users to manually construct it or even inspect
> it if possible.

What? People need to know what the assigned index is.
